Choosing the Right Size for Your Living Room
Before purchasing a quadruple sofa, it is essential to consider the size of your living room and how the sofa will fit within it. Here are some tips to help you determine the right size for your living room:
1、Measure the Available Space: Start by measuring the available space where you want to place the sofa. This should include the walls, doors, and any other obstacles that may affect the placement of the sofa. Make sure to leave enough space for walking around the sofa and accessing furniture in the room.
2、Consider the Number of Seats: A quadruple sofa typically accommodates four individuals comfortably. However, if you have a larger group of friends or family members, you may need to consider a larger or modular sofa design that can be arranged in different configurations based on your needs.
3、Think About Traffic Flow: When placing the sofa in your living room, consider how people will move around it. A corner sofa with a narrow entryway can make it challenging for people to enter and exit the seating area comfortably. Similarly, if the sofa is placed against a wall, it may limit traffic flow in the room.
4、Don't Forget About Stairs: If your living room has stairs leading up to it, you'll need to factor in the additional space required for climbing up or down steps when calculating the size of the sofa.
5、Consider the Style and Purpose of Your Sofa: The style and purpose of your sofa will also play a role in determining its size. For example, if you prefer a modern and minimalist look, you may opt for a compact and sleek quadruple sofa. On the other hand, if you want a more traditional and comfortable feel, you may choose a larger and more ornate version.
